PARIS: The Leapmotor C10 REEV (range extender electric vehicle) is arriving at European dealerships starting mid-April 2025.
The C10 REEV offers a combined WLTP range of over 970km, and flexible charging options, including DC, AC, and onboard fuel generator.
In the run-up to its arrival at European dealerships, the company organised a series of marketing events including an international media drive in Spain where stunning roads and the Spanish warm weather was the perfect testing ground.
A long journey between Barcelona and Valencia allowed the lucky drivers to appreciate the innovative range-extender technology, which effectively addresses range anxiety.
Since its launch, the Leapmotor C10 has been a standout performer.
In March, the C10 achieved record-breaking deliveries of 12,000 units in China, contributing to a cumulative total of 100,000 units since its launch.
Meanwhile, carnewschina.com reported that the 2026 model year Leapmotor C10 in China will see an improved powertrain and equipment including a 74.9 kWh battery and CLTC range of 605km.
The 2026 C10 also has a more powerful electric motor with a peak output of 220kW (295hp), which is 50kW (67hp) higher than its predecessor.
Other updates include a new purple body shade, and a 50W wireless charging pad.
